Rodarte Presents Spectacular ‘Come Back’ Show At The NYFW S/S 2019

Leaving the New York Fashion show for more than 2 years, Rodarte has finally found its way back to the New York Fashion Week, this time presenting its Spring 2019 collections.

Making a great deal of their return to the New York Fashion Week, Rodarte decided to present its spring collection at New York City Marble Cemetery, under the directives of Kate and Laura Mulleavy. The show had models strutting in full dark regalia under the rain as the looks and the choice of venue made it a collaborative look emanating from the ghosts of party ladies in the 80s. The sister designers tried to reinforce the notion of a unique but durable collection with great aesthetics and graphic imprints and layered frocks. The collection was able to cut through serious plains and also double up with fashion cuteness with massive flowery details. See more photos of the collection below; Photo Credit: Getty
